Author: amilas Date: Wed Oct 31 03:02:56 2007 New Revision: 590610 URL: http://svn.apache.org/viewvc?rev=590610&view=rev Log: fixed an binary handling problem
Modified: webservices/axis2/trunk/java/modules/adb-codegen/src/org/apache/axis2/schema/template/ADBBeanTemplate.xsl Modified: webservices/axis2/trunk/java/modules/adb-codegen/src/org/apache/axis2/schema/template/ADBBeanTemplate.xsl URL: http://svn.apache.org/viewvc/webservices/axis2/trunk/java/modules/adb-codegen/src/org/apache/axis2/schema/template/ADBBeanTemplate.xsl?rev=590610&r1=590609&r2=590610&view=diff ============================================================================== --- webservices/axis2/trunk/java/modules/adb-codegen/src/org/apache/axis2/schema/template/ADBBeanTemplate.xsl (original) +++ webservices/axis2/trunk/java/modules/adb-codegen/src/org/apache/axis2/schema/template/ADBBeanTemplate.xsl Wed Oct 31 03:02:56 2007 @@ -1366,8 +1366,8 @@ <xsl:if test="not(@primitive)"> <xsl:choose> - <xsl:when test="$propertyType='java.lang.String[]'"> - xmlWriter.writeCharacters(<xsl:value-of select="$varName"/>[i]); + <xsl:when test="@binary"> + xmlWriter.writeDataHandler(<xsl:value-of select="$varName"/>[i]); </xsl:when> <xsl:otherwise> xmlWriter.writeCharacters(org.apache.axis2.databinding.utils.ConverterUtil.convertToString(<xsl:value-of select="$varName"/>[i])); --------------------------------------------------------------------- To unsubscribe, e-mail: [EMAIL PROTECTED] For additional commands, e-mail: [EMAIL PROTECTED]